Key Features of the App Launcher

Among its standout features is an Equispaced Grid that adjusts to display all your applications, no matter the screen size or the number of apps installed. This design ensures that every application is within reach, allowing for a comprehensive view of all available resources.

Additionally, the inclusion of a Graphical Fisheye Lens elevates the interaction experience. This feature lets users quickly zoom, pan, and launch apps using simple touch gestures. Such a system is based on the Graphical Fisheye Lens algorithm, which is a well-regarded method rooted in academic research.

Technical Aspects and Implementation

The Graphical Fisheye Lens algorithm, central to the app's functionality, is derived from methods proposed in academic literature. This foundational approach, initially explored in 1993, has been adapted to modern technology needs, ensuring it meets contemporary user expectations.
